How to Maximize Workflow Automation with Microsoft Power Automate for Increased Efficiency
In today’s fast-paced business environment, maximizing efficiency is crucial for staying competitive. One way to achieve this is through workflow automation, which can streamline repetitive tasks and free up valuable time for more important activities. Microsoft Power Automate is a powerful tool that enables organizations to automate workflows across various applications and services. In this article, we will explore how to maximize workflow automation with Microsoft Power Automate for increased efficiency.
1. Identify and Prioritize Workflow Processes:
The first step in maximizing workflow automation is to identify the processes that can benefit the most from automation. Start by analyzing your existing workflows and identifying repetitive tasks that consume a significant amount of time. Prioritize these processes based on their impact on productivity and efficiency.
2. Design and Build Automated Workflows:
Once you have identified the workflows to automate, it’s time to design and build the automated workflows using Microsoft Power Automate. Power Automate provides a user-friendly interface that allows you to create workflows without the need for coding skills. You can choose from a wide range of pre-built templates or create custom workflows tailored to your specific needs.
3. Integrate Applications and Services:
Power Automate allows you to integrate various applications and services, such as Microsoft Office 365, SharePoint, Dynamics 365, and more. By connecting these systems, you can automate data transfer, notifications, approvals, and other tasks seamlessly. This integration eliminates the need for manual data entry and reduces the risk of errors.
4. Utilize Triggers and Actions:
Triggers and actions are the building blocks of Power Automate workflows. Triggers initiate the workflow based on specific events or conditions, while actions define the steps to be taken once the trigger is activated. Power Automate offers a wide range of triggers and actions that can be combined to create complex workflows. By utilizing these triggers and actions effectively, you can automate multiple steps in a process, saving time and effort.
5. Leverage AI and Machine Learning:
Power Automate also incorporates AI and machine learning capabilities, allowing you to automate more complex tasks. For example, you can use AI Builder to extract data from documents, classify emails, or analyze sentiment. By leveraging these advanced capabilities, you can further enhance the efficiency of your automated workflows.
6. Monitor and Optimize Workflows:
Once your workflows are up and running, it’s essential to monitor their performance and make necessary optimizations. Power Automate provides real-time analytics and reporting features that allow you to track the progress of your workflows, identify bottlenecks, and make data-driven decisions for improvement. Regularly reviewing and optimizing your workflows will ensure they continue to deliver maximum efficiency.
7. Collaborate and Share Workflows:
Power Automate enables collaboration by allowing you to share workflows with colleagues or external partners. This feature promotes teamwork and knowledge sharing, as team members can contribute to the development and improvement of workflows. By leveraging the collective expertise of your team, you can maximize the benefits of workflow automation.
In conclusion, Microsoft Power Automate is a powerful tool that can significantly enhance workflow automation and increase efficiency within organizations. By identifying and prioritizing workflow processes, designing and building automated workflows, integrating applications and services, utilizing triggers and actions, leveraging AI and machine learning, monitoring and optimizing workflows, and promoting collaboration, organizations can maximize the benefits of Power Automate for increased efficiency. Embracing workflow automation with Power Automate will not only save time and effort but also enable employees to focus on more strategic tasks, ultimately driving business success.
